Prof. (Dr.) Atul Prakash, currently working as Professor & Head in Department of Veterinary Pharmacology and Toxicology, College of Veterinary Science and Animal Husbandry, U.P. Pt. Deen Dayal Upadhyaya Pashu Chikitsa Vigyan Vishwavidyalaya Evam Go-Anusandhan Sansthan (DUVASU), Mathura-281001 (Uttar Pradesh), India. He has more than sixteen years of experience in teaching and research in Veterinary Pharmacology and Toxicology. His research interest is Metabolic disorders, Endocrine Pharmacology particularly diabetes and associated cardiovascular complications and experimental pharmacology. He has been recipient of International travel grant from Council of Scientific and Industrial Research, Govt. of India, New Delhi and Department of Biotechnology, Govt. of India, New Delhi to present research work in EUROTOX 2009 at Dresden Germany. He has authored more than 50 research articles in peer reviewed journals and worked as Supervisor for more than fifteen Master’s and PhD research scholars.
